Transaction 39ff5238ace4f2820c95b6015e7528b8547047fa019f8f1a0fff64593135e703
1 Input
2 Outputs
- 39ff5238ace4f2820c95b6015e7528b8547047fa019f8f1a0fff64593135e703:0
- 39ff5238ace4f2820c95b6015e7528b8547047fa019f8f1a0fff64593135e703:1
value 17982
address 1MHkFLvY6R7s8nmgncHA1ph7zFfMWuwyMm
value 57423753
address 1GSE5nHZWnywwnCpZstQ5hmSBj4qWC9bww